Three design cottages with studios located in Shirahama, Minamiboso.

Le Phare Resort is located in Shirahama, the southernmost tip of Minamiboso, Chiba Prefecture, an area known for its mild climate throughout the year and its picturesque scenery. Designed by Minoru Kuroki, an award-winning architect who received the Chiba Prefecture Architectural Culture Award, the resort features three design cottages. These cottages offer a simple yet comfortable space furnished with carefully selected furniture, providing a perfect environment to refresh both your mind and body."Le Phare" means "lighthouse" in French. The resort was named with the hope of always illuminating the hearts of our guests, much like the beautiful Nojimazaki Lighthouse designed by French engineer Verny. It also symbolizes a place where guests can always return, guided by its light.Each cottage is equipped with a studio, which can be used as a house studio for band recordings, rehearsals, or photo shoots. The studios are also available for activities such as music, dance, or yoga.

Spacious accommodation featuring a cypress bath and a small garden. A traditional wooden Kyoto townhouse offering a nostalgic atmosphere.

You can choose from two Rooms: "Mibu Doudan" and "Mibu Momiji." Maximum capacity is 6 guests, and up to 2 medium-sized dogs are allowed. Please present proof of rabies vaccination and general vaccination at check-in. One free parking space is available per Room. Parking space dimensions: "Mibu Doudan" 190cm x 500cm, "Mibu Momiji" 240cm x 500cm. The pet cage dimensions are 76cm in depth, 161cm in width, and 70cm in height. The Property has been renovated to preserve the charm of traditional Japanese architecture while incorporating modern comfort. Guests can enjoy the nostalgic scents and atmosphere of the past. A traditional 100-year-old private rental accommodation engraved with the stories of Ojika Island.

Supervised by Alex Kerr, a researcher of Eastern culture. A traditional Japanese house over 100 years old has been renovated into a comfortable space while preserving its charm and the beauty of Japan. This accommodation breathes new life into the island as a place where you can spend your time richly and meaningfully. From samurai residences to fishermen's houses overlooking the port, each building is a unique cultural resource that continues the rich history of this flourishing island. Entirely private accommodations for one group per house—experience time in an authentic "island home." Relax and enjoy your stay at your own pace.
